    RR olympic and sprint

    To disable ads, please log-in.

    First of all I learned a lesson on the swim. I put sunblock on and it made my goggles all slippery and let water in and then mixed with the sunblock, BURNED my eyes, so I stopped several times on the swim to wash eyes out. 28 mins. Bike, 8 steep climbs of 8% each 1k, which meant slow up, very fast down. By the 6th or 7th I could barely keep going. 1:41. Run, felt fine and thought I was going fast, but a friend told me "boy were you going slow!", so alas, felt fine, but my own rhythm. 1:07, total 3 hours 21.
    Saturday swam and ran a little to loosen up.
    Sunday, Sprint, now this was totally different. A whole different show. Mentally I knew I only had 4 climbs, so I went up mostly standing and really pumping on harder gears, and flying down like a bat out of he--. Jumped off the bike and raced into the run, 29mins. A total of 1 hour 31, less than half what I did on Friday, with only one day of recovery from the Olympic. Now that was TOTALLY cool. But the best part of the whole experience was that today, Monday, after two tris, I am totally fine, no muscle soreness, no pain, no extra fatigue, just kind of like I hadn't done much. Now I am worried if I didn't try hard enough
